- The distance between Analalava, Madagascar and Kumasi, Ghana is approximately 5,938 km or 3,690 mi.
- To reach Analalava in this distance one would set out from Kumasi bearing 113.8°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Analalava bearing 110.1° or ESE .
- Both have a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Analalava is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Kumasi is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 0.5 °C (0.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.4 °C (0.7°F) less in Analalava.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 156.3 mm (6.2 in) more which is equivalent to 156.3 l/m² (3.84 US gal/ft²) or 1,563,000 l/ha (167,095 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.1° lower in Analalava than in Kumasi.
